Juventus are anticipating clarity in the next 48 hours regarding the feasibility of signing Jadon Sancho.
Initial discussions between Juve and Manchester United have been positive, with two potential deal structures under consideration. One option is a straightforward cash transfer, while a player swap could also be on the table.
Sancho is reportedly keen on the prospect of moving to Italy for a fresh start in Serie A. However, despite mutual interest, significant challenges remain—primarily surrounding salary negotiations.
Currently, Sancho’s wages at United exceed what Juventus can afford. Italian sources suggest that Juve’s maximum offer would be around £160,000 per week, and while there are murmurs that Sancho may be open to a pay cut, this has yet to be substantiated. Should his salary requirements not change, the likelihood of the transfer happening appears slim.

Manchester United’s preference is for a cash-only transaction, with an initial price tag set at £25 million. However, there is a growing sentiment that they may accept a lower figure of between £15 million and £20 million to facilitate a smooth exit for Sancho.
This would mark a significant depreciation on a player they acquired for £73 million, but for Sancho, there seems to be no route back into the squad.
A swap deal remains a possibility, with Douglas Luiz being mentioned as a potential inclusion. United are keen on enhancing their midfield options and view Luiz as an established player who could provide immediate impact. Given the financial constraints, United is exploring options that provide quality without heavy cash outlay.
Juventus are eager to finalise this transfer within the week, necessitating prompt confirmation on whether Sancho is indeed a feasible signing.
Sancho will not participate in the initial group of players returning for pre-season training at United. The club has made no arrangements for his reintegration and is prioritising a swift resolution to his future.
